If there’s one thing we know about anime, it’s that everything seems more exciting in 2D. The beginning of a school year doesn’t mean less free time and more math homework, it means encountering a mysterious transfer student under an eternally blossoming sakura tree! Being a maid isn’t about doing tedious housework that no one wants to do, it’s about serving your master and tending to his psychological needs! (Or in some cases, protecting your master through whatever bizarre means necessary.)

Likewise, in the world of anime, mahjong is not just mahjong. It’s epic mahjong. In fact, it’s epic Crazy Loli Yuri Mahjong. But is this trend to lean towards the over dramatic a good thing? How does the use of extreme exaggerations affect the viewer, especially when the line is crossed by a mile?
